The Federation Starship Emden, a Ranger class starship[1] commanded by Captain C. Thomas, was on peacekeeping missions between the Romulans and the Klingons in Sector 21803, near Alpha Bayard, on Stardate 9522.6 when it was included in plans for Operation Retrieve.[2] The ship was named for the city in Germany on Earth.[3]
